Surprisingly good but limited use.
Not a fan of canned vegetables but this was a case of needs must, during this crisis period when trying to get fresh foods proved to be far too stressful.This canned spinach is best for dahls, stews and soups. I used it to make spinach-rice, half a can to 250gm of basmati rice, 1 can of coconut cream using this can to add 2 cans of warm water to which dissolved 3 vegetable stock cubes, 1 star anise (or a piece of cinnamon) , some fresh thyme. Mixed it all in the special plastic rice-cooker for microwave then let it cook in the microwave for 10mins, stir it and cook for a further 5mins until its fluffy and moist (not wet and claggy), it should resemble 'Thai-style' sticky coconut rice but with spinach. Use it as a vegetarian dish or accompaniment for a fish or meat dish.
